How to Make Arizona Chicken Chili
- Dice 1 pound of boneless, skinless chicken breasts into 1/2-inch chunks.
- In a medium saucepan, combine the chicken, one 28-ounce can of undrained Del Monte diced tomatoes, and 2 tablespoons of chili powder.
- Cook over medium heat for 5-7 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the sauce has slightly thickened. Stir occasionally.
- Add 1 (15-ounce) can of kidney beans (drained and rinsed), 1/2 cup of chopped onion, 1/4 cup of chopped green bell pepper, and 1 teaspoon of cumin. Stir well.
- Simmer for 5-7 minutes, or until heated through and flavors have melded.
- Garnish with shredded cheddar cheese (1/2 cup), diced avocado (1/4 avocado per serving), sliced radishes, or chopped green onions, as desired.
- Serve hot. Makes 4 servings.
